One year, a group of doctors held a fundraiser and sent $35,885 to a clinic in need of support. Each year after that, the doctor

s sent another $2500
After how many years will the total amount sent by the doctors first exceed $250,000?
Mathematics
1 answer:
Doss [256]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

86 years after the $35,885 donation is made

Step-by-step explanation:

Let n be the total number of years.

Each year they sent $2500, so in n year they send 2500n dollars.

They sent $35,885 to start with, so after n years, they will have sent a total of

2500n + 35,885

We need to find the value of n for which 2500n + 35,885 exceeds $250,000.

2500n + 35,885 > 250,000

2500n > 214,115

n > 214,115/2500

n > 85.6

The first year after 85.6 years have passed is year 86.

Find an expression which represents the difference when (6x-3y) is subtracted from (9x+2y) in simplest terms.
Alex73 [517]

Answer:

3x+5y

Step-by-step explanation:

Subtract (6x-3y) from (9x+2y):

(9x+2y)-(6x-3y)

This can also be seen as:

(9x+2y)-1(6x-3y)

Distribute the -1 to (6x-3y):

(9x+2y)-1(6x)-1(-3y)\\\\(9x+2y)-6x+3y

Simplify the parentheses:

9x+2y-6x+3y

Group like terms:

(9x-6x)+(2y+3y)

Combine:

3x+5y

This expression can't be further simplified. Therefore, 3x+5y is the answer.
